Planning application submitted for 16 new council homes in Northway


Oxford City Council has submitted a full planning application for 16 new council homes at Maltfield House in Northway, replacing the derelict former children’s home with a fully affordable housing development.

The new homes are planned to be energy efficient and accessible, with an all-electric design and low-carbon technologies. The homes will be available for social rent and are intended to help meet demand from people on Oxford’s housing register.

Subject to planning permission, construction is expected to progress towards completion in 2028.

The scheme is being delivered directly by Oxford City Council through its Housing Revenue Account and forms part of the council’s wider Affordable Housing Supply Programme, which aims to deliver 2,000 new homes over the next decade.
